Descrição de bancos de dados lógicos

Objective

After completing this lesson, you will be able to descrever os conceitos de PNP, PNPCE e PCH

Bancos de dados lógicos: funções

Os bancos de dados lógicos são programas ABAP especiais que recuperam dados e os disponibilizam para processamento em programas de aplicação e consultas. Esses bancos de dados fornecem uma visão específica das tabelas de banco de dados no sistema da SAP.

Os bancos de dados lógicos podem executar as seguintes tarefas:

  • Obtenção de dados

    Na obtenção de dados, os dados pessoais para cada empregado são carregados para a memória principal, onde estão disponíveis para processamento.

  • Seleção

    Em uma tela de seleção, você pode selecionar empregados de acordo com critérios organizacionais; por exemplo, você pode recuperar dados para todos os horistas em uma determinada parte da empresa.

  • Verificação de autorização

    Na verificação de autorização, o sistema verifica se o usuário que inicia um relatório está autorizado a visualizar os dados no relatório.

Melhorias de performance em bancos de dados lógicos são transmitidas a todos os programas e queries relacionados, sem que eles próprios precisem ser modificados.

Bancos de dados lógicos

O sistema inclui os seguintes bancos de dados lógicos que permitem a você criar InfoSets para HR:

  1. PNPCE (substituirá PNP)
  2. HCP

O banco de dados lógico que você precisa utilizar ao criar um InfoSet é determinado pelos componentes de RH nos quais você precisa reportar.

A tabela a seguir lista as atribuições entre componentes e bancos de dados lógicos:

ComponenteBanco de dados lógico
Administração de RHPNP ou PNPCE
Gerenciamento de temposPNP ou PNPCE
Folha de pagamentoPNP ou PNPCE
Evolução de recursos humanosHCP
Administração organizacionalHCP
E-RecruitingHCP
Solução de aprendizagem/Enterprise LearningHCP
Planejamento de SucessãoHCP

Banco de dados lógico PNPCE

O banco de dados lógico PNPCE deve substituir o banco de dados lógico PNP. Para notificar dados da administração de pessoal, cálculo da folha de pagamento ou gerenciamento de tempos, você deve utilizar o banco de dados lógico PNPCE para criar InfoSets.

O banco de dados lógico PNPCE oferece as seguintes funcionalidades:

  • O PNPCE pode ser usado com empregos simultâneos. Para mais informações sobre empregos simultâneos, consulte a nota SAP 517071.
  • O PNPCE contém as seguintes ampliações e novas funcionalidades:
    • Caixa de listagem personalizável para definir o período de relatório que é intuitivo e fácil de usar
    • Simplificação da especificação individual de períodos de seleção de pessoas e dados
    • Integração de período de relatório e período processado na folha de pagamento em uma tela (nenhuma modificação de tela necessária)
    • Tela de seleção claramente estruturada com todos os botões na barra de ferramentas da aplicação geral
    • Exibição claramente estruturada de opções de seleção dinâmicas (opcionalmente como uma caixa de diálogo, como PNP)
    • Suporte para IDs de seleção ao selecionar números pessoais

As ampliações podem ser utilizadas independentemente do conceito de empregos simultâneos. A SAP recomenda a utilização de PNPCE para todos os desenvolvimentos novos.

Nota

O banco de dados lógico PNP continuará sendo suportado.

Administração de pessoal e modelo de dados de recrutamento

Os infotipos são unidades de informação em HR. Os infotipos agrupam campos de dados coerentes.

Os infotipos são formas de estruturar informações que são reportadas por relatórios ou consultas. Para preservar o histórico de infotipos, o sistema grava os mesmos em registros específicos de tempo. O sistema registra um período de validade para cada registro de infotipo. Normalmente, existem vários registros de dados para cada um dos infotipos de um empregado. Os registros são distinguidos por seus períodos de validade diferentes.

Utilizando as seguintes ligações temporais, você indica como os registros de dados de um infotipo reagem uns aos outros ao longo do tempo:

  • Ligação temporal 1

    Para o tempo que um empregado pertence à empresa, deve existir exatamente um registro de dados válido de um determinado infotipo.

  • Ligação temporal 2

    Em qualquer momento específico, pode existir no máximo um registro de dados válido de um determinado infotipo.

  • Ligação temporal 3

    Em qualquer momento específico, podem existir registros de dados válidos ilimitados de um determinado infotipo.

Para que exista um número pessoal, devem existir os infotipos Medidas (0000), Atribuição organizacional (0001), Dados pessoais (0002) e Status do cálculo das folhas de pagamento (0003).

Banco de dados lógico PCH

Você utiliza o banco de dados lógico PCH se quiser notificar dados dos seguintes componentes:

  • Administração organizacional
  • Planejamento de custos de pessoal
  • Evolução de recursos humanos
  • E-Recruiting
  • Solução de aprendizagem/Enterprise Learning
  • Planejamento de Sucessão

Se você criar InfoSets utilizando o banco de dados lógico PCH, pode restringir o InfoSet utilizando um tipo de objeto.

O InfoSet só pode ser utilizado para ad hoc query se tiver sido restringido mediante um tipo de objeto. Neste caso, o sistema só permite que você selecione infotipos relevantes para o tipo de objeto selecionado.

Se você não restringir o InfoSet utilizando um tipo de objeto, o sistema permite que você selecione todos os infotipos disponíveis no banco de dados lógico PCH.

Modelo de dados do planejamento de recursos humanos

A administração organizacional baseia-se no conceito de que cada elemento em uma organização é representado como um objeto independente com características individuais. Esses objetos são criados e atualizados individualmente e, em seguida, conectados entre si utilizando ligações, como exibido no precedente. Isso cria uma rede flexível que permite a você executar o planejamento de recursos humanos, visualizações e relatórios.

Uma vez que os centros de custo não são atualizados na administração organizacional, eles são um tipo de objeto externo.

Por exemplo, no customizing, você pode ampliar o modelo de dados existente definindo novos tipos de objeto e permitindo novas ligações entre tipos de objeto.

Cada nome do tipo de objeto padrão é composto por uma ou duas letras. O espaço de nomes de cliente é de 00 a 99.

Este modelo de dados (tipos de objeto e ligações) também é a base para outras aplicações de planejamento de recursos humanos, como Administração de treinamento e eventos (hierarquias de eventos) e Evolução de recursos humanos (catálogo de qualificações).

Relatórios sobre dados de PNP ou PNPCE e PCH

Um InfoSet só pode ser baseado em um banco de dados lógico. Por isso, você só pode selecionar um banco de dados lógico para criar um InfoSet.

Em cada uma das seguintes situações, que podem surgir para os bancos de dados lógicos PNP e PCH, você precisa decidir qual banco de dados lógico deve ser utilizado para criar um InfoSet correspondente:

  • Você quer emitir dados dos infotipos 0000-0999 e dados de alguns infotipos do banco de dados PCH, como os infotipos Evolução de recursos humanos ou Administração de treinamento e eventos.

Neste caso, você deve trabalhar com o banco de dados lógico PNP ou PNPCE. Se você criar um InfoSet utilizando PNP ou PNPCE, pode incluir infotipos de PCH no InfoSet.

  • Você quer executar um relatório sobre todos os infotipos de dados mestre de pessoal.

Neste caso, você deve trabalhar com o banco de dados lógico PCH. Ao criar o InfoSet, não selecione um tipo de objeto (nesse caso, você só pode trabalhar com SAP Query) ou selecione o tipo de objeto P (Pessoa) ou S (Posição).